Could He Lead?
I think Recoiled gets his chance to lead over 1000m here and that will prove the winning move. First-up he cracked under pressure and fought on bravely when forced to sit outside speed demon Three Votes. Second-up was slowly away and held up at crucial stages. Third Up if he can jump quickly I think Recoiled can lead. Marchand will give a strong showing on speed as he does week in, week out. Clobberetta broke a long drought to win last start for apprentice Mollie Clark. Pike jumps aboard here and she should get a lovely tow into the race from barrier 1. Delicate Miss will settle midfield and if she can get the right splits will be right in the finish. Volkoff is the class mare of the field but carrying 59.5kg first-up on a track where she notoriously struggles, you can count me out. Furious Dame back to 1000m drawn the outside barrier for a horse who is actually quite slow out of the gates considering her racing pattern, another you can leave me out of. This is a wide open leg of the quaddie and probably a field job for most players.
